Middle Abbey Street and North Frederick Street have been chosen for a ‘bold urban-rejuvenation’ pilot scheme.
Gardaí and nurses will be among ‘key workers’ eligible to rent in the new low-cost Dublin city homes.
But, who should be considered a key worker and will they be able to afford these new cost rental schemes?
Joining Andrea to discuss is Chair of the Urban Redevelopment Working Group, Soc Dems Cllr Cian Farrell, former Garda inspector in north central Dublin, former Deputy-Secretary of the AGSI and current Risk, Security & Event Manager of Ashtree Risk Group, Tony Gallagher and listeners.
